What are the key components of a division worksheet?

A division worksheet typically includes a series of division problems to solve, with a dividend, divisor, and quotient provided for each problem. The worksheet may also include space for students to show their work or write out the steps they used to solve each problem. In addition, some division worksheets may contain word problems or real-life scenarios that require division to solve, helping students apply their division skills in practical situations.

How can you choose appropriate numbers for division problems?

When choosing appropriate numbers for division problems, consider the relationship between the dividend (the number being divided) and the divisor (the number you are dividing by). The numbers should be such that the division will result in a whole number or a decimal that makes sense in the context of the problem. Additionally, ensure that the divisor is not zero to avoid undefined results. Choose numbers that are easy to work with based on the level of difficulty of the problem you are solving, and adjust them as needed to simplify the calculation.

How do you set up a division problem on the worksheet?

To set up a division problem on a worksheet, write the dividend (number being divided) inside a long division bracket, then write the divisor (number dividing the dividend) outside the bracket. Divide the first digit of the dividend by the divisor to get a quotient, then multiply the divisor by the quotient and write the result below the dividend. Repeat the process for the next digit of the dividend until all digits have been divided. Write the final answer as the quotient with any remainders if present.

What strategies can you use to solve division problems?

When solving division problems, you can use strategies such as long division, short division, repeated subtraction, grouping, or using multiplication (inverse operation). It is important to understand the relationship between division and multiplication and to practice dividing numbers of varying complexities to improve your skills. Additionally, breaking down the numbers into smaller, more manageable parts can help make the division process easier. Remember to double-check your results and practice regularly to build your division proficiency.

How can you incorporate word problems into the division worksheet?

You can incorporate word problems into a division worksheet by presenting real-life scenarios that require division to solve. For example, you can describe a situation where a pizza needs to be divided among a certain number of people, or a scenario where a group of friends wants to share a certain amount of money equally. By framing the problems in relatable contexts, students can understand the application of division in everyday situations and enhance their problem-solving skills.

How can you differentiate the division worksheet for various levels of learners?

To differentiate the division worksheet for various levels of learners, you can provide different levels of difficulty. For lower-level learners, you can include simpler division problems with smaller numbers and fewer steps. For higher-level learners, you can include more complex division problems with larger numbers and multiple-step problems. Additionally, you can provide visual aids or manipulatives for struggling learners to help them understand the concept better, while giving more challenging word problems for advanced learners to apply their division skills in real-life scenarios.
